The Art and Other Ideas project was created to explore the connections between art and other areas of knowledge. Through lectures and discussions, the project promotes encounters between artists, researchers, and the public, highlighting how art can be a tool for understanding and reflecting on the most diverse aspects of society and the world around us.


With an interdisciplinary approach, the lectures of Art and Other Ideas explore the intersection between art and science, revealing how scientific concepts can be transformed into artistic expressions that enrich the understanding of complex themes. The project also shows how artistic creativity has the potential to inspire new approaches and research in the field of science, creating a bridge between creative intuition and scientific rigor.
The Art and Other Ideas project also recognizes the importance of art as a tool for social mobilization, especially in environmental issues. The project brings to light creations and discussions that seek to promote awareness and inspire actions in favor of sustainability and environmental preservation, showing how art can engage and sensitize society to urgent topics.
